Identifying Forex Scams & Avoiding Trickery

The foreign exchange market can be a lucrative opportunity, but it's also rife with unscrupulous individuals seeking to take advantage of unsuspecting traders. Identifying potential Forex scams is paramount to protecting your money and maintaining a rewarding trading experience. Be wary of promises of risk-free profits, unsolicited investment propositions, and pressure to invest quickly. Thoroughly research any firm before depositing money, checking for legitimate regulation from recognized agencies like the FCA, ASIC, or CySEC. Validate the company’s contact information and look for consistent client reviews, being mindful that some online feedback may be fake. Never ignore your intuition; if something seems too good to be true, it probably is. Finally, consistently educate yourself about Forex trading techniques and the inherent risks involved.

Here's a simple list to help with detection:

  • Unrealistic profit claims
  • Time-sensitive sales tactics
  • No regulatory oversight
  • Substandard websites
  • Obscure terms and conditions

Broker Review Scam Exposed

A disturbing phenomenon of fraudulent platforms has been identified, targeting unsuspecting investors. These sham review portals often present a apparently unbiased assessment of trading firms, but in reality, they are secretly paid to promote certain businesses while smearing competitors. The deceptive reviews are designed to influence potential clients, leading them to think that a particular broker is reliable when, in fact, they may be untrustworthy. Be extra cautious when researching brokers – always check information from multiple, truly unbiased sources. Never solely rely on a single asset recovery specialists review site; explore the broker’s authorization with the appropriate authorities to guarantee their honesty. The financial consequences of falling for these fraudulent schemes can be severe, potentially leading to damage to finances. Remember due diligence is your best protection against this widespread issue.
